LUCKNOW: Janvi Baliyan and Chandani Sharma bowled superbly to help favourites Uttar Pradesh crush Rajasthan by five wickets to step forward for a knockout berth in the Women's Under-19 One-day Trophy, at the Vidarbha Cricket Association Stadium at Nagpur on Friday.

Baliyan took 3/13, whereas Sharma bagged 3/19 as Rajasthan could score 78 in 36 overs while batting first after winning the toss. Barring openers Shreya and Pearl Bamnawat, no other batter could touch the double figure-mark.
